Give information as asked about the following mineral nutrients in plants:
a. Iron:
i. it is a constituent of-, ii. it's one typical deficiency symptom.
b. Zinc:
i. the group of enzymes it activates,
ii. it is needed for the synthesis of -.
c. Phosphorus:
i. the form in which it is absorbed from the soil,
ii. its deficiency effect on seed germination.
